Introduction to the Incident
The westbound lanes of Highway 401, a major thoroughfare in southern Ontario, were closed for several hours on Monday morning due to a shooting incident. The incident occurred around 1:30 a.m. ET and involved two vehicles, according to the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) Highway Safety division. The police have reported that road rage may have been a factor in the shooting, which is currently under investigation. The OPP has shared photos of the victim’s vehicle, a red Hyundai, which shows visible bullet holes in the body of the car.

Investigation and Road Closure
The westbound lanes of Highway 401 were closed following the shooting incident, causing disruptions to traffic in the area. The closure was in place for several hours, with the lanes reopening shortly after 7 a.m. ET. The OPP is urging anyone with information or dashcam footage to contact the Cambridge OPP to assist in their investigation.
